JAA PPL to fATPL in 10 weeks - Where's the catch?

I have looked at a couple of US-based schools on the net, namely EFT and Angel City Flyers:

http://www.digital-reality.co.uk/acf/

I was wondering what the catch was at AFC since they claim to take you from JAA PPL to fATPL (JAA & FAA) for £13800 in 10 weeks! It appears the main element lacking are the JAA ATPL exams which cost around £800.

EFT seem to offer a modular joint JAA & FAA fATPL for $26000, which lasts a more realistic 50+ weeks.

I know there are potential nightmares with US JAA IR courses, so would be gratfeul for any comments regarding these schools .
